Think About How Much Contrast You Will Want

Another key aspect of exterior colors involves the contrast associated with painting the exterior of a home. In fact, some homeowners enjoy a harsh contrast that makes a bold statement while others prefer exterior colors that are less contrasting and actually compliment one another. The reality is, having a better idea of just how much contrast you want for the exterior of your home is a great starting point when trying to decide on what colors to paint the exterior of your home.
